Comfrey & Plantain


This combination made the famous ‘Boyles Syrup’, so much used for dry Coughs and Coughing up Blood in particular. It is also the main combination in the Syrup of Comfrey.
    
Comfrey is Cool, Moist, and Sweet. It is astringent, helps stop Bleeding while also gently moving the Blood, and is very good for healing internal Ulcers, Hernias and other ‘ruptures’. It is good for Coughs from dryness, weakness, chronic Lung disease and Yin deficiency. It clears Heat and Inflammation, while nourishing Yin and Blood.
    
Plantain is Cool, Sweet and Bitter. It is good to clear Heat and Toxin, especially from the Lungs, Stomach and Bladder, and is also mildly astringent and healing. It can be used to stop Bleeding, and is useful for Cough and acute Infections of the Lungs.
    
Together they clear Heat from the Lungs, stop Cough, promote Healing and stop Bleeding. Used for harsh, dry Cough, including that with Blood. It may be used for Cough, Bronchitis, Upper Respiratory tract infection, as well as an adjunctive in Chronic Lung Disease with Cough, Wheezing and Blood in the Sputum etc.

This combination also appears together in the Styptic Decoction, also used for Hemorrhage.

Key Indications
  • Cough, Bronchitis, Upper Respiratory tract infection
  • Hemoptysis; other Heat-type Bleeding

Additions
1. Cough associated with chronic Lung disease, add Licorice, Raisins and Pine nuts
2. Lung Ulcers, add Licorice and Figs
3. Acute spasmodic coughs, with Thyme and Aniseed.

Examples
Decoction Against Lung Ulcers, Styptic Decoction, Decoction for Wounds, Comp. Syrup of Comfrey, Plaster for Fractures
